Q: Is 310,502,742 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 310,502,742 is a composite number.

Why is 310,502,742 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 310,502,742 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 11 22 33 37 43 66 74 86 111 129 222 258 407 473 814 946 1,221 1,419 1,591 2,442 2,838 2,957 3,182 4,773 5,914 8,871 9,546 17,501 17,742 32,527 35,002 52,503 65,054 97,581 105,006 109,409 127,151 195,162 218,818 254,302 328,227 381,453 656,454 762,906 1,203,499 1,398,661 2,406,998 2,797,322 3,610,497 4,195,983 4,704,587 7,220,994 8,391,966 9,409,174 14,113,761 28,227,522 51,750,457 103,500,914 155,251,371 and 310,502,742, with no remainder.

Since 310,502,742 cannot be divided by just 1 and 310,502,742, it is a composite number.
